Established in 2014 as Nigerias first licensed private commodities exchange, AFEX's infrastructure and platforms drive capital to build a trust economy in Africas commodity markets. We provide solutions in trading, financing and market system development.

The role holder is responsible for driving and promoting the listing of commodity-linked securities on the exchange by identifying, evaluating, and recommending potential issuers, ensuring a consistent growth in the number and quality of listings.
In order to be successful in this role, you will have to demonstrate innovative skills, analytical competence, as well as have a deep interest and understanding of the capital markets and the investment landscape, both domestic and foreign.
Responsibilities
Conduct research and analysis to understand industry trends, competitors, and potential growth sectors.
Identify, cultivate, and onboard potential companies, ensuring a steady pipeline of potential listings.
Work closely with potential issuers, guiding them through the listings process.
Attend industry events, participate in roadshows, and conferences to promote the exchange as the preferred listing venue.
Build and maintain relationships with intermediaries, such as investment banks, law firms, auditors, corporate finance houses, and other transaction advisers to guide companies to list commodity-linked instruments on the Exchange.
Coordinate with internal teams to ensure seamless processing of all listing applications.
Work on continuously refining and streamlining the listing process.
Ensure all listing applications are complete and meet the required standards.
Maintain up-to-date records of all communications and applications.
Organize workshops, seminars, and webinars for potential listees about the benefits and processes related to listing.
Analyze the viability, profitability, and risk associated with new listings on the Exchange.
Stay updated on regulatory changes and guidelines in the capital market.
Support in developing product marketing materials and training resources.
Track and evaluate the performance of new listings, using metrics to identify areas for improvement or modification.
